Lupanar (Brothel) Sign, Pompeii :

In Pompeii; Penises can be found not only as graffiti roughly drawn and carved onto public walls, but built into the roads as well.

It is guessed that phallic symbols on the streets point towards nearest brothel, to direct foreign sailors who may be heavily intoxicated and/or unable to speak the local language.
